How to know you need to remove a tree
There are a variety of signs that will alert you that a tree ought to be removed.
Damage to half or greater of the tree
When there is considerable damage to half or more of the tree and you can see it from the ground it is a likely sign that you will want to have it removed.
Primary trunk is split
When the trunk of the tree is cracked or broken vertically, it impairs the tree significantly, and it ought to be removed. Vertical fissures can additionally be a signal that there is decomposition inside the tree.
A sizable branch has broken
If a big branch or limb has broken off from the tree, this will generally cause serious degeneration and weaken the tree a lot. It might be a good idea to have it cut down.
Dead Roots
Dead, broken down, or weak roots will cause a tree to be unsteady, lean and fall over. This can be hazardous and it is a smart idea to cut down the tree.
Tree is Leaning
When a tree is leaning over, it is at risk of falling over, and can be hazardous. Falling over into a building, utility line, street, or onto a person can be a serious issue. Safety should always be a main priority.
Dead Trees
Dead trees can rapidly become infested with pests such as termites, rats, ants, and wood boring insects. This infection can spread quickly to your house, and other nearby trees or buildings. It’s wise to have a dead tree removal company remove the tree prior to it causing more damages.
